My son is 6. He was diagnosed at 4 with Aspergers. They say possibly adhd but are hesitant to diagnose at this young age. He has been at full speed since he came out of my body lol.
His stimming seems to be with him all the time these days. Its been getting worse in public lately. Or maybe it just seems that way because he is getting bigger. It's always big movements like spinning and running and falling on the ground. He hangs on me and makes loud noises. It truly seems like he can't control it.
I'm just so tired. Sometimes I just need to go to the store or run an errand. What can I do to help him control his body in public? Any advice or tips or tools?

My children are "undisciplined" relative to others, so my advice may be minimally helpful. My NT husband and I (Aspie) have the kids in big spaces as much as possible, e.g. one of us takes them outside. My thought for small spaces are alternatives: when my son (NT?) is too out there or too close, I give him piggy-back rides (he's near 6 and I'm late 40s) so his hanging on is in the "right" spot. Thankfully they are both sometimes willing to get in the cart (or hold on) for shopping, usually with a toy, especially if they've been running around beforehand. We gave my son chewlery around age 5 to stop his clothes gnawing. My daughter (Aspie) age 8, flaps her hands a LOT now. We've talked briefly about alternatives (clapping, stimulating the vagus nerve in other ways - you can Google). Her teachers say she does not flap in her classrooms, but once when I picked her up, as soon as the left her classroom, her flapping was so hard up and down she could have taken flight. My NT husband is physically active, so keeps her moving - biking, swimming; I lost weight so I can chase them around on the playgrounds without tiring before them. "Excessive" physical activity also helped a foster child of ours who was ADHD, PTSD etc.

Bottom line: I give my children suggestions, but don't expect "control". That said, if they are too "wild" I will remove them from the situation with as little fuss as possible. Then I ask my NT husband to run the errands. ;)

Stimming is usually an unconscious way of self-calming. It is actually necessary to your child staying in control and functioning. In public, if the stims are bothering you or those around you, I suggest you work to channel them into a more socially acceptable format without trying to stop it. Give you son something to manipulate to keep his hands busy, or engage in a conversation to keep his voice busy (assuming he is verbal). My son was a chewer so I usually handed him straws to chew; something like that may also help with the unwanted noises.

An increase in stims should be taken as a sign that a situation is stressing your child. Consider making a mental note to avoid those situations or find a way to make them less stressful.

If you can't find a way to channel the energy, you might be able to make a deal with him to delay the movements. Or stave off the need for a highly active session before heading out. Keep any time periods you are asking him to intentionally suppress his movements very short. Trying to control the movements will take the full energy of his brain and be stressful of itself. Be sure this is necessary and important with no other alternatives before you ask it of him. It rarely will be.

You will find, as Eikonabridge explained in detail, that your child's brain learns and focuses best while he is stimming. Doing homework it helps him learn; in a stressful situation it helps him cope.

Most important to note is that this is NOT a behavior issue, so please don't treat it as something bad; it is a coping mechanism and should be handled as such. The moment I learned that one simple fact about my son everything got so much easier. I had been fighting a battle that was actually leading to more disruptive and destructive behavior from my child. By letting him engage in the silly little stuff, I had a much better behaved child for the big stuff. Pick your battles.
